5 Best Netflix Crime Dramas To Watch After Dear Child

By Matthew Lynch
March 8, 2024
0
Spread the love

Crime dramas have a way of keeping viewers on the edge of their seats, pulling them into a world of suspense, mystery, and the complex human psyche. Following the intense experience of “Dear Child,” you might be looking to keep that thrill going. Here are five Netflix crime dramas that will guarantee you more hours of captivating storylines and heart-pounding investigations.

1.Mindhunter: This gripping series delves into the early days of criminal psychology and profiling at the FBI. It’s based on the true-crime book “Mindhunter: Inside the FBI’s Elite Serial Crime Unit” and follows agents Holden Ford and Bill Tench as they attempt to understand and catch serial killers by studying their damaged psyches. The show is an intense psychological drama that explores the depths of human depravity.

2.Narcos: A gritty portrayal of the life of Pablo Escobar, this series dives into the rise and fall of one of the world’s most notorious drug lords and the efforts made by law enforcement to bring down his criminal empire. “Narcos” seamlessly blends real-life events with dramatization, offering a raw look at the war on drugs in Colombia.

3.Ozark: This original series introduces viewers to Marty Byrde, a financial planner who relocates his family to the Ozarks following a money-laundering scheme gone wrong that endangers them all. As they become entangled with local criminals, each season escalates with tension, presenting Marty with moral quandaries and danger at every turn.

4.The Sinner: Each season of this anthology crime drama features a new story led by Detective Harry Ambrose as he investigates troubling murder cases that uncover hidden truths and compelling mysteries within seemingly ordinary individuals. Its exploration of why ordinary people commit brutal acts adds a layer that’s both hauntingly engaging and emotionally resonant.

5.Broadchurch: Although not an exclusive Netflix production, this British series is essential viewing for crime drama enthusiasts on Netflix. Focusing on two detectives—Alec Hardy and Ellie Miller—as they investigate the death of a young boy in a small coastal town, this show is lauded for its character development, storytelling, emotional impact and exploration into how a tragic event can affect a community.

Each of these dramas offers a unique approach to storytelling, complex characters, and deep dives into crime investigation that will fill the void left by “Dear Child.” Happy watching!
